Voss Still Water 500

I would never pay for this water- it's far too expensive and for no good reason. However, when I stayed at The W a while back, Voss water was all they had. Luckily it also comes in still water. (Normally only Voss Sparkling Water is all you can get.) And being the water snob that I am, I can honestly say that the water itself wasn't bad. It didn't taste funky like fancier waters do (i.e. Evian), and it definitely had a fresh and crisp taste to it. But so do cheaper waters like Dasani! So the only distinguishing thing about Voss is a fancy bottle and the status it gets you. Never have I had a water bottle that caught so much attention. I brought it to work and refilled it with our water cooler water, and pretty much anyone that saw it had some sort of comment. "That's quite a water bottle...Voss? Sorry big baller....Is that vodka or water in there?" You get the idea.

So all in all, the water is good. The bottle is great if you want attention and to up your status. But is it worth $10 a bottle? That's up to you. :P

Cashmere-Silk Pashmina - (For Women)

I absolutely love pashminas! They are so functional and versatile. One day it's a warm scarf keeping me ever so warm on a cold day. The next day it's an elegant wrap at the latest gala. You can wrap it around your neck, or drape it over your shoulders, even tie it up front. It's whatever tickles your fancy and suits you style.Pashminas are different from standard scarves because they are wider in length and sometimes have thinner fabric. Often they are made of a much more delicate fabric. So the one caveat to them is that hey have to be dry cleaned or sometimes hand washed. But hey, that's the price you pay for quality!
